Description

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

Support the following core technologies: VMware vSphere, Microsoft Windows Servers, Cisco Nexus, Cisco Catalyst, Cisco UCS, Palo Alto, Citrix, Office 365, IBM servers, and storage.

Work with cross-functional teams including IT, Management, and consultants in the design and implementation of information technology that meets stated business objectives and service levels.

Analyze, recommend, and evaluate new technologies including hardware, software, and communications products for network compatibility and applicability.

Assist in the design, deployment, and maintenance of corporate LANs, WANs, and wireless networks including servers, routers, switches, VoIP, power systems, and other hardware.

Assist in the planning, design, and implementation of security systems and their associated software, including firewalls, VPNs, intrusion detection systems, and anti-virmalware software.

Test new technologies and proposed changes to current infrastructure in a zero-impact lab environment.

Receive and respond to incoming calls, pages, and/or e-mails regarding network connectivity problems and respond to emergency network outages in accordance with business continuity procedures.

Perform preventative and fault isolation maintenance on the local and wide area networks.

Perform advanced diagnostics and maintenance on all network hardware assets while troubleshooting end-user devices when additional expertise is required.

Design and implement disaster recovery plans for operating systems, databases, networks, servers, and software applications.

Assume contractual management responsibilities by assisting in requests for proposals/quotes, vendor selection, and contract monitoring.

Participate in the development of system standards, short and long-term goals, project management, and strategic directions.

Create and maintain documentation as it relates to network hardware, configuration, processes, and service records.

Develop, maintain, and update a library of technical documentation

Design and implement appropriate IT metrics and compliance controls.

Assist co-workers engaged in problem-solving, monitoring, and installing data communication equipment and software.

Participate in on-call rotation to ensure 24/7 operations of all critical systems.

Education and Experience:

Bachelor's degree in an Information Technology field or equivalent technical experience related to systems, networking, security and communications in a corporate environment preferred.

5+ years of relevant hands-on experience.
